MongoDB
 sql >> डेटाबेस >  >> NoSQL >> MongoDB

MongoDB - तार्किक या पूर्ण पाठ खोज का उपयोग करके शब्दों और वाक्यांशों की खोज करते समय

मैंने दस्तावेज़ों को पाठ खोज पर तलाशा , और मुझे डर है कि मुझे नहीं लगता कि यह मोंगोडीबी 2.6 के रूप में संभव है। MongoDB का टेक्स्ट सर्च सपोर्ट एक वास्तविक पूर्ण टेक्स्ट सर्च इंजन (उदाहरण के लिए ल्यूसीन टेक्स्ट सर्च लाइब्रेरी के साथ निर्मित सोलर/चीजें) जितना पूर्ण नहीं है। अभी, टेक्स्ट प्रश्नों में बूलियन ऑपरेटरों के लिए कोई समर्थन नहीं है, इसलिए आप "देर से देरी \"समय पर\"" के अर्थ को "(देर से या देरी) और (\"समय पर\")" से "देरी से" में नहीं बदल सकते। या देरी या \"समय पर\""। टेक्स्ट के अलावा या इसके अलावा टोकन की एक सरणी को संग्रहीत करने, या ElasticSearch जैसे पूर्ण टेक्स्ट सर्च इंजन के साथ सिंक्रनाइज़ करने से जुड़े कुछ कामकाज हो सकते हैं, लेकिन मैं किसी की सिफारिश करने से पहले क्वेरी के उपयोग के मामले के बारे में कुछ और जानना चाहता हूं समाधान।




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. मोंगोडब एटलस:कमांड निष्पादित करने के लिए व्यवस्थापक पर अधिकृत नहीं है

  2. MongoDB mongorestore और रिकॉर्ड के साथ मौजूदा संग्रह

  3. मोंगोडब:$ या खोज में () का उपयोग करते समय मिलान किए गए फ़िल्टर लौटाएं

  4. MongoDB:दूसरे संग्रह के आधार पर एक संग्रह से सशर्त चयन

  5. एसएनएमपी के साथ क्लस्टर कंट्रोल को एकीकृत करना:भाग दो